This file has been signed using my personal key.
You can find my key in the Kaffe.org keyring,
as well as the Debian keyring, on my personal
website at jimpick.com, and on keyserver.net.

To check the signature of the file, first
import my key into your trust database, and
do something like:

$ gpg --verify kaffe-1.1.9.tar.bz2.sig kaffe-1.1.9.tar.bz2
